During a roundtable discussion in Anderson on Friday, Governor Mike Braun said he was disappointed lawmakers removed a provision that would have reset property tax rates to what they were in 2021.
The Governor said he wants local governments and schools that say his property tax plan could hurt them financially to prove it.
“I’m going to be able to see every county, every jurisdiction who did and who didn’t, and then I think, they’ll have to probably answer to their own constituents and make the case why they wouldn’t be for something that is that reasonable,” said Gov. Braun.
The House Ways and Means Committee will have its first discussion on the senate property tax bill on Wednesday.
